Oneida Students who register for this particular program will learn the latest phlebotomy processes, including prevention of pre-analytic errors in the lab, skin puncture and blood collection, special procedures, legal situations in phlebotomy, electrocardiograph and vital signs, venipuncture, basic medical terminology, ways to complete challenging draws, collection gear, anatomy, physiology, and customer service skills.
